Python 错误:IndexError: index 2343 is out of bounds for axis 0 with size 800 解释与解决方法
很抱歉,报错信息'IndexError: index 2343 is out of bounds for axis 0 with size 800'表明你试图访问索引为2343的元素,但是该索引超出了数组的大小。具体来说,数组的大小为800,而你尝试访问索引为2343的元素,超出了数组的范围。
这个问题可能出现在代码的某个地方,可能是在读取数据集、训练网络模型或者其他处理数据的地方。你需要检查代码中涉及索引的部分,确保索引值在数组的合法范围内。
建议你检查以下几个可能的原因:
- 是否使用正确的索引变量来访问数组元素,特别是在循环中。
- 是否在数据处理过程中改变了数组的大小,导致索引超出了新的数组大小。
- 是否在使用索引时没有进行边界检查,导致越界访问。
检查代码中的这些部分,找到引起报错的具体位置,并修复问题即可。
原文地址: https://www.cveoy.top/t/topic/rfo 著作权归作者所有。请勿转载和采集!